(<< Back to Hotel Antares) Nick from UK wrote on 09.05.2005: The Antares is a real gem of a hotel in a quiet and attractive residential area. The hotel is a very brisk 10 minutes walk to the edge of the Old Town, which was ideal for me. I enjoy walking!! However, there is a trolley bus stop very close to the hotel. There are a couple of local bars between the hotel and town, however, very quickly you are in the heart of the Old Town surrounded by bars and eating places. For some, the location may be a little out of the centre, but it was so peaceful. Excellent location for me.
The Antares is a new hotel and during my stay, was extremely under populated. However, I am sure once it gets discovered by the discerning traveller, it will become busy and summer prospects are probably very good. Rooms are very well appointed, buffet breakfast excellent and a lovely small garden at the rear. A minor comment, perhaps the reception staff could be just a little friendlier-maybe it was a culture or language thing-but I noticed others have said the same.
